The French newspaper "90 minutes" revealed six names nominated to win the title of best player in the world for 2020 in the difficult season that was interrupted by the Corona crisis, and the short list witnessed six names, including the Egyptian star Mohamed Salah.

The newspaper said: "The big stars are nominated to compete for the" Balloon Dor "award in the event that it is repeated in conjunction with the return of life to the major European leagues and the conclusion of most of them. ".
The newspaper added that "Mohamed Salah played an important role last year in the victory of Liverpool in the European Champions League and Club World Cup, and he continued to shine in the current season and was able to contribute to winning the English Premier League title and returning to the Reds safes after an absence of 30 years."

Lionel Messi, the Argentine star, won the award last year, as he excelled in the final vote on Liverpool defender Virgil Van Dyck, in addition to Juventus player, Cristiano Ronaldo, and Mohamed Salah finished fifth after he was third last year.


List of six players
 Robert Lewandowski (Bayern Munich)
 Cristiano Ronaldo (Juventus)
 Lionel Messi (Barcelona)
 Kevin de Bruyne (Manchester City)
Killian Mbappe (Paris Saint-Germain)
Mohamed Salah (Liverpool)
